M/V Dolphin Queen


Our live-aboard, M/V DOLPHIN QUEEN has a wooden monohull. The Dolphin Queen has 3 decks. The main deck has 6 cabins for our guests. 2 Double bed, 1 Twin Bunk bed, and 3 Quad (4) Berth cabins these cabins are fitted with curtains for each bunk bed for your privacy.
All cabins have their own air conditioner and a sea view window that opens. There are 2 more cabins with double beds on the upper deck these are our sea view cabins when you open the cabin door the view is the ocean and islands. All cabins have 220v plugs, so you can charge your battery packs or your lights.

The upper deck has 2 Double bed cabins for guests and where you can find the wheel house (captains quarters) at the bow. At the stern is the eating area. Here you can help yourself with coffee, tea, toast, water, electrolyte drinks, fruits which are always on the table for your convenience.

The dinning area has 3 tables on the sides with sofa seatings and 1 extra table in the center for cameras, etc. The sides of the boat are open so you can enjoy the good weather to the maximum.

On the main deck at the stern is the Dive Platform and gearing up area for your diving equipment which has more than ample room to put on and store your dive gear we also have 40 Luxfer 12 ltr Tanks we use INT connection, we do have DIN adapters and 15 ltr tanks for rent.
There are also 2 Bauer Mariner II compressors with an air cooling system with P41 air filters to give you the best Quality air.
Always close at hand are the Similan Diving Safaris boat crew, who are there to help you gear up and help you on your dive entry and exit. The crew will fill the tanks so all you do is dive. Most of the time you will be picked up by our boat or our dingy.
There are 3 spacious toilets with showers and 2 showers on the dive deck.
The galley is also on the main deck. The food is prepared by the cook and her assistant cook.
We cater for Veg and none Veg, and any other special needs you require.

On the Sun Deck is lots of room for getting your tan, we also have a couple of hammocks & sundeck chairs under our new shade on the back of the sun deck, This is a nice place for spotting Dolphins, Manta rays and Whale sharks while travelling to new dive sites and up here your always the one to spot the Dolphins first.
